  1. Mingus is the tenth studio album by Canadian musician Joni Mitchell. It was released on June 13, 1979, and was her last studio album for Asylum Records. [1] The album is a collaboration between Mitchell and Charles Mingus.

  5. 13 de jun. de 2022 · As the 80s began, Joni Mitchell started to retreat from experimentation. Mingus, therefore, is not only an elegy for the dying jazz icon, but it is also the final hurrah of Mitchell’s expansive, creative decade – the crowning album of one of the most innovative periods of any artist.
